Understanding PrimeXBT
PrimeXBT stands out as a platform that allows users to trade various assets, including cryptocurrencies, forex, and commodities. With a user-friendly interface and a range of trading tools, it caters to both novice and experienced traders. Key features include leverage trading, which significantly increases potential profits, and a variety of asset offerings that widen trading opportunities.
Advantages of PrimeXBT
- Leverage Trading: PrimeXBT offers up to 100x leverage on crypto markets, allowing traders to maximize their gains.
- Diverse Asset Choices: The platform supports trading in a variety of assets, not just cryptocurrencies, which is ideal for those looking to diversify.
- Robust Trading Tools: Advanced charting tools and indicators provide traders with valuable insights for informed decision-making.
- Intuitive Interface: The platform is designed for ease of use, making it accessible for new traders while still offering advanced features for seasoned professionals.
Disadvantages of PrimeXBT
- Limited Deposit Options: PrimeXBT primarily supports crypto deposits, which might limit options for some users.
- High Risk with Leverage: While high leverage can lead to substantial profits, it also increases the potential for significant losses.
- No Fiat Trading: The absence of direct fiat trading can be a barrier for users wanting to enter the crypto market without first converting money.

1. Binance
Binance is one of the largest cryptocurrency exchanges in the world, known for its vast selection of coins and trading pairs. It supports spot trading, futures, and margin trading, making it customizable for various trading strategies. Additionally, Binance offers staking options and has its own native token (BNB) that provides trading fee discounts.
2. Kraken
Kraken is another reputable platform that offers a mixture of fiat and cryptocurrency trading. Known for its security and regulatory compliance, Kraken is a great choice for users looking for peace of mind in their trading. The platform supports margin trading and has a wide array of cryptocurrencies available.
3. Bitfinex

Bitfinex is targeted more towards experienced traders, providing substantial leverage options and a variety of trading tools. It offers both cryptocurrency and fiat trading, supporting a wide range of orders and trading types. Bitfinex is also well-regarded for its liquidity, which is vital for large traders.
4. Bybit
Bybit is a derivative trading platform focused mainly on cryptocurrency perpetual contracts. It provides a sleek interface and real-time market information, catering well to traders interested in leverage trading without the traditional complexities of various asset classes.
5. eToro
eToro is unique in its social trading feature, allowing users to copy the trades of successful investors. The platform facilitates trading in both crypto and traditional markets, making it versatile for various investors. While eToro is more focused on a beginner-friendly experience, it lacks some advanced trading features found in other platforms.
